Modi’s government argues that because the law applies to refugees from Islamic countries, India need not offer special protection to Muslims. Some could rely on the new citizenship law to gain status — but not Muslims. “There is absolute political consensus within the BJP that India is culturally a Hindu country,” said Milan Vaishnav, director of the South Asia program at the Carnegie Endowment for International Peace. With more protests planned across the country, India’s Supreme Court is due to hear arguments Wednesday that the citizenship law is unconstitutional.
